Creatine for Strength and Muscle: Dosage, Benefits, and Expectations
August 4, 2026
Creatine is one of the few supplements that consistently improves high-intensity training performance. It will not transform your strength overnight, but it can help you perform more quality work and progress faster over time.
The practical approach is simple: use creatine monohydrate, take it consistently, and judge the result through your training log rather than day-to-day feelings.

The simple answer
For most healthy adults who lift weights, 3–5 grams of creatine monohydrate per day is a practical, evidence-supported dose.
You do not need to cycle it. You do not need an expensive variation. Timing is far less important than taking it consistently.
A loading phase is optional:
- Loading: Around 20 grams per day, divided into four 5-gram servings, for 5–7 days
- Maintenance: 3–5 grams per day afterward
- Without loading: Take 3–5 grams daily and allow several weeks for muscle stores to rise
Loading works faster, but it is not more effective in the long run. It may also cause more digestive discomfort or a quicker increase in body weight.
How creatine supports hard training
Your muscles use adenosine triphosphate, or ATP, to produce force. Stored ATP is limited, especially during short bursts of demanding work.
Creatine is stored in muscle partly as phosphocreatine. During intense effort, phosphocreatine helps convert used energy molecules back into ATP. This process is fast, which makes it particularly useful for efforts such as:
- Heavy sets of low-to-moderate reps
- Short sprints
- Jumps and explosive movements
- Repeated high-intensity intervals
- Multiple hard sets with incomplete recovery
This energy system contributes most during the opening seconds of intense work. It cannot power an entire workout, but increasing stored creatine can give you a slightly larger energy buffer.
That difference may mean one extra rep, better repetition speed, or less performance loss across repeated sets.
Creatine does not magically increase strength
Creatine is often described as a strength supplement, but that description needs context.
Taking it does not automatically add weight to your bench press. It may improve your ability to complete productive training. Over several weeks and months, that extra work can support better strength and muscle gains.
For example, suppose you normally perform three sets with the following result:
- Set 1: 10 reps
- Set 2: 8 reps
- Set 3: 7 reps
After your creatine stores increase, you might eventually manage 10, 9, and 8 reps at the same weight. That is three additional quality repetitions across the exercise.
One workout will not change your physique. Repeating that small advantage across many workouts can matter.
What results should you expect?
The effects are useful but not dramatic. Creatine works best when the rest of your training is already structured.
You are more likely to notice:
- A small improvement in repeated high-intensity performance
- Better maintenance of reps across hard sets
- Gradual support for strength progression
- A modest increase in body weight
- Slightly fuller-looking muscles
The initial weight increase is largely caused by more water being stored within muscle tissue. This is not body fat, and it is not the same as looking generally bloated.
Responses vary. People with lower starting muscle creatine stores may notice more benefit. This can include people who eat little or no meat or fish, although diet does not perfectly predict individual response.
Creatine from food versus supplementation
Your body can produce creatine from amino acids, and you can also obtain it from foods such as meat and fish.
That means creatine is not an essential nutrient in the same way that certain vitamins are. Avoiding meat does not automatically create a clinical deficiency, provided your overall diet supplies adequate energy and protein.
However, obtaining a standard supplemental dose from food alone would require a large amount of meat or fish. Supplementation is simply a more practical way to raise muscle creatine stores consistently.
Creatine monohydrate is the default choice. It is widely studied, effective, and usually inexpensive. Alternative forms are often marketed as superior, but research has not consistently shown them to produce better training results.
Does timing matter?
Not much.
You may take creatine:
- Before training
- After training
- With a regular meal
- At any convenient time on rest days
Taking it with food may make it easier on your stomach. The best schedule is the one you can follow every day.
Do not turn timing into another source of unnecessary optimization. Muscle saturation develops through repeated daily intake, not a perfectly timed serving before one workout.
What about cognitive benefits?
The brain also uses creatine in cellular energy management, so researchers have examined possible effects on memory, processing, and mental performance.
The findings are promising in some situations, particularly when baseline creatine intake is low or when people are under unusual mental stress. However, the cognitive evidence is less settled than the evidence for repeated high-intensity exercise.
Do not assume that a large single serving will function like an instant mental stimulant. Creatine does not normally produce an obvious rush, and higher doses are more likely to create digestive problems.
If your main goal is gym performance, the standard daily dose remains the sensible starting point. There is not enough practical reason for most lifters to take very large doses specifically for a same-day cognitive boost.
Common mistakes
Expecting an immediate difference
Creatine is not a pre-workout stimulant. Without loading, it may take several weeks to meaningfully increase muscle stores.
Taking it only on training days
Consistency matters more than workout timing. Take it on rest days too.
Changing several variables at once
If you start creatine, replace your program, increase calories, and alter your sleep schedule simultaneously, you will not know what affected your performance.
Confusing water weight with fat gain
An early increase on the scale is expected for some people. Compare waist measurements, photos, and longer-term weight trends before assuming you gained fat.
Buying a complicated formula
A longer ingredient label does not make creatine work better. Plain monohydrate is the practical standard.
Ignoring the basics
Creatine cannot compensate for poor programming, insufficient protein, inconsistent sleep, or sets that are never taken close enough to muscular failure.
How to test whether it helps your training
Use a simple four-step process:
- Keep your main exercises stable for at least six weeks.
- Take 3–5 grams of creatine monohydrate every day.
- Record your load, reps, sets, and effort.
- Compare performance across multiple sessions, not isolated personal records.
Look for trends. Are you completing more reps at the same weight? Can you increase the load while staying within your target rep range? Are later sets becoming more consistent?
You should also keep rest times reasonably stable. Taking three minutes one week and six minutes the next makes the comparison less useful.
Safety and tolerance
Creatine monohydrate is generally considered safe and well tolerated for healthy adults at standard doses.
The most common practical issues are temporary weight gain and digestive discomfort. If 5 grams at once upsets your stomach, take it with a meal or divide the dose.
Normal creatine use may also affect certain blood test markers without necessarily indicating kidney damage. If you have kidney disease, are pregnant, take medication that affects kidney function, or are being medically monitored, discuss supplementation with your clinician.

Summary
Creatine monohydrate is a well-supported option for improving repeated high-intensity performance.
For most lifters, the useful rules are straightforward:
- Take 3–5 grams every day
- Use creatine monohydrate
- Treat loading as optional
- Do not obsess over timing
- Expect possible water-weight gain
- Measure results over several weeks
- Keep training, nutrition, and recovery as the priorities
Creatine can provide a small performance advantage. Structured training determines whether that advantage turns into more strength and muscle.
